什么编程语言不内卷了

fiy 其他 5

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    目前,编程语言内卷现象层出不穷,但有一些编程语言相对来说较少内卷。以下是几种不太容易内卷的编程语言:

    1. Python:Python是一种简洁、易学且功能强大的编程语言。它以优雅的语法和强大的标准库著称,可以快速实现各种功能。Python的设计理念注重人类可读性和简洁性,减少了内卷的可能性。

    2. JavaScript:JavaScript是一种广泛应用于Web开发的脚本语言。它具有灵活的语法和强大的功能,能够与HTML和CSS无缝集成。JavaScript的开放性和生态系统的发展使得它难以内卷,因为社区可以快速对语言进行改进和扩展。

    3. Rust:Rust是一种系统级编程语言,它注重安全性、性能和并发性。Rust具有先进的内存管理机制,能够在编译时防止内存错误和数据竞争。由于其严格的语法和类型系统以及内存安全特性,Rust减少了程序员使用复杂技巧进行内卷的可能性。

    4. Go:Go是一种由Google开发的编译型编程语言,它注重简洁性、效率和可靠性。Go拥有快速的编译和执行速度,以及强大的并发性能。它的设计理念包括清晰的语法、标准化的代码风格和丰富的标准库,有利于减少内卷。

    5. Julia:Julia是一种高级、动态的编程语言,专注于科学计算和数据分析。它具有灵活的语法和高性能的执行速度,能够有效处理大规模数据和复杂计算。Julia的设计理念借鉴了其他语言的优点,并注重可读性和扩展性。

    这些编程语言相对来说较少内卷,可帮助开发者更加注重代码的可读性、简洁性和安全性,以及提高开发效率和程序性能。当然,内卷问题不仅与编程语言本身有关,还与开发者的使用方式和项目需求有关,因此在实际开发中,需要综合考虑各方面因素来避免内卷。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在当前的编程语言市场中,有一些编程语言在不断更新和发展中,以适应不同的需求和趋势。虽然内卷概念与编程语言有一定的关联,但编程语言的内卷程度并没有绝对的标准。因此,我们无法给出一个确切的答案来回答“什么编程语言不内卷了?”这个问题。然而,我们可以讨论一些具有较低内卷程度的编程语言。

    1. Python: Python 是一种高级编程语言,以其简洁优美的语法、易读易写的特点而受到广泛欢迎。它具有丰富的库和框架,支持各种功能和应用。由于其简单易学的特性,Python 成为很多初学者和非专业开发者的首选语言。

    2. JavaScript: JavaScript 是一种用于前端开发的脚本语言。它在网页开发中非常流行,并且随着 Node.js 的出现,JavaScript 也能够用于后端开发。JavaScript 有着活跃的社区和庞大的生态系统,开发者可以很容易地找到所需的工具和资源。

    3. Go: Go 是由 Google 开发的一种编程语言,为了提高开发效率而设计。它具有静态类型、垃圾收集等特性,适用于构建高性能的网络服务。Go 的语法简洁明了,并且具有良好的并发支持,使得并发编程变得更加简单和安全。

    4. Rust: Rust 是一种系统级编程语言,注重安全、并发以及内存管理。它的设计目标是提供高性能、可靠性以及可维护性。Rust 不仅支持硬件级别的控制,还具有功能强大的类型系统,能够在编译期间捕获常见的错误。

    5. Swift: Swift 是一种由苹果开发的编程语言,主要用于开发 iOS、macOS 和其他苹果平台的应用程序。它结合了 Objective-C 的动态特性和 C 的性能,具有现代化的语法和强大的应用程序开发工具。Swift 的学习曲线较为平缓,并且有着活跃的开发者社区。

    这些编程语言虽然在不同的领域和应用中具有较低的内卷程度,但其受欢迎程度和使用率仍然较高。由于编程语言的发展是一个动态的过程,故本回答中列举的编程语言不一定在未来也保持相同的情况,编程语言的内卷程度将取决于市场需求和技术发展的趋势。因此,对于想要选择一门较少内卷的编程语言来学习的人来说,还是应该根据自己的需求和兴趣来进行选择和评估。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    近年来,在编程语言领域出现了不少新兴语言,这些语言意在解决现有编程语言的不足和瓶颈,以提供更好的开发体验和效率。下面将介绍几种当前较为流行的编程语言,它们在不断的发展中对传统编程语言进行了改进,降低了内卷性。

    一、Rust
    Rust是一种系统级编程语言,由Mozilla开发并于2010年首次发布。Rust最大的特点是内存安全性和并发性,在编写安全和高性能软件方面具有很大的优势。Rust使用了一种称为“借用检查器”的机制来管理内存的使用,有效地避免了空指针异常和数据竞争等常见的编程错误。此外,Rust还拥有良好的模块化和泛型编程支持,使得开发者能够轻松地构建可靠和可维护的代码。Rust的生态系统也在不断壮大,有许多开源项目和库可以用于各个领域的开发。

    二、Kotlin
    Kotlin是一门由JetBrains开发的通用编程语言,它可以运行在Java虚拟机(JVM)上,也可以被编译成JavaScript。Kotlin在语法上与Java相似,但添加了很多新特性,使得编写代码更简洁、安全和易读。Kotlin具有空安全、扩展函数、数据类等特性,可以大大减少编写冗余代码的时间和工作量,提高代码的可读性和可维护性。此外,Kotlin与Java的互操作性良好,可以很方便地与现有的Java代码进行集成,逐步迁移到Kotlin上。因此,Kotlin在Android开发中受到了广泛的欢迎,并成为了一种替代Java的选择。

    三、Go
    Go是由Google开发的一种静态类型的编译型语言,专门用于高效地构建可靠和高可伸缩性的软件。Go继承了C语言的语法和风格,但删除了一些复杂和容易出错的特性,使得代码更简洁和易读。Go具有垃圾回收机制、协程和信道等特性,可以非常方便地实现高并发的编程,提供了强大的并行计算能力。此外,Go还拥有丰富的标准库和强大的工具链,使得开发者能够快速地构建出高效、稳定的应用程序。

    四、Swift
    Swift是苹果在2014年发布的一种新型编程语言,特别适用于iOS、macOS和watchOS等平台的应用程序开发。Swift在语法上借鉴了C、Objective-C和其他一些语言,但引入了很多新特性,使得代码更简洁和易读。Swift具有强大的类型推断、可选类型、泛型和面向协议的编程等特性,提高了代码的可靠性和可维护性。此外,Swift还在安全性和性能方面进行了改进,为开发者提供了更好的开发体验和效率。

    综上所述,Rust、Kotlin、Go和Swift是当前较为流行的不内卷的编程语言。它们在语法和特性上进行了创新和改进,提供了更好的开发体验和效率,对于提高软件质量和开发效率具有积极的影响。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部